The Breast Cancer Score in 60656, Chicago, Illinois is 65 out of 100 when comparing 34,000 ZIP Codes in the United States.

74.33 percent of the population in 60656 drive to work alone. 13.28 percent of the people take some form of public transportation like the bus or the train to work. Approximately 41.47 percent of the residents get to work in less than 30 minutes. 13.95 percent of the residents in 60656 get to work in more than 60 minutes. The average household size is approximately 2.21 members with about 1.87 cars available per household.

An estimate of 89.67 percent of the residents in 60656 has some form of health insurance. 30.50 percent of the residents have some type of public health insurance like Medicare, Medicaid, Veterans Affairs (VA), or TRICARE. About 70.89 percent of the residents have private health insurance, either through their employer or direct purchase.

A resident in 60656 would have to travel an average of 1.59 miles to reach the nearest hospital with an emergency room, Amita Health Resurrection Medical Center . In a 20-mile radius, there are 0 healthcare providers accessible to residents in 60656, Chicago, Illinois.

As of , an estimate of 28,665 residents live in 60656 with a median age of 40.2 years. 19.15 percent of the population is under the age of 18, and 17.67 percent of the population is at least 65 years of age. 36.74 percent of the residents in 60656 is currently married, and 23.25 percent of the population has never been married.

The monthly median household income in 60656 is $7,489.75. The monthly median housing costs for residents in 60656 is approximately $1,275. The median household spends about 17.02 percent of their income on housing.

Breast Cancer is a type of cancer that forms in the cells of the breast. It is the second most common type of cancer diagnosed in women in the United States, with over 250,000 new cases expected to be diagnosed in 2021 alone. For individuals living with Breast Cancer, regular medical appointments are crucial for ongoing treatment and monitoring of their condition.
